Default VOIP analog phone adaptors and phone network

Hi all,
I am getting ready for my first VOIP contract activation. I have a Sipura PAP2 adaptor I intend to use. The adapter has two independent phone outputs which letsme to have two lines at the same time.
I wonder if it will be possible to connect my existing phone network - three phones where one of them is wireless? I don't know if the adaptor can handle multiple phones load as I was going to connect cable from one of the outputs to the wall phone sockets (I realise the wiring will have to be slightly altered).

Have done this many times in my line of work no problems
Don't know why they put 2 lines on thier units because you will get problems if you use both lines at the same time but it does enable you to have 2 providers
A lot of cordless phones cause echo some worse than others
